Abstract

The invention discloses an antistatic wood flour-PET (Polyethylene glycol Terephthalate) composite material and a preparation method thereof. The antistatic wood flour-PET composite material comprises the raw materials in parts by weight: 50-70 parts of PET, 30-50 parts of wood flour, 4-8 parts of a composite coupling compatilizer and 1-3 parts of a composite antistatic agent. The composite antistatic agent comprises the components in parts by weight: 10-30 parts of stearamidopropyl dimethylamine-beta-ethoxyl quaternary ammonium nitrate, 30-60 parts of dodecyl dimethyl betaine, 20-40 parts of N, N-bi(2-hydroxyl ethyl)-N-(3'-dodecyloxyl-2'-hydroxyl propyl) methyl sulfate methyl ammonium and 5-10 parts of (3-lauramidopropyl)trimethyl sulfate methyl ammonium. The antistatic wood flour PET composite material prepared by the invention has impact strength, bending strength and modulus of elasticity, in particular low surface resistance, and the material has the antistatic property on the surface and does not absorb dust, so that the product is maintained attractive for a long time.

Antistatic wood powder PET composite material and preparation method thereof
Technical field:
The present invention relates to a kind of Wood-plastic material and preparation method thereof, particularly a kind of antistatic wood powder PET composite material and preparation method thereof.
Background technology:
Along with global economic development, over nearly more than 20 years, the consumption of plastics rises rapidly, and waste or used plastics rubbish pollution on the environment is also day by day serious.The forest reserves are cut down in a large number simultaneously, cause great destruction to ecotope.Therefore protect forest resources, preserve the ecological environment and become the target that the new millennium mankind pursue jointly.
Wood plastic composite (WoodPlasticsComposites, be called for short WPC) be the modified thermoplastic material of filling with wood powder, xylon or vegetable fibre, strengthening, have the cost of timber and plastics and the advantage of performance concurrently, section bar, sheet material or other goods are obtained through shaping, there is quality light, cost is low, little to equipment attrition, the advantages such as environmental protection.
Polyethylene terephthalate chemical formula is-OCH2-CH2OCOC6H4CO-English name: polyethylene terephthalate, and being called for short PET, is high polymers, by ethylene glycol terephthalate generation dehydration condensation.Ethylene glycol terephthalate is by terephthalic acid and ethylene glycol generation esterification gained.PET is oyster white or polymkeric substance that is light yellow, highly crystalline, and surface smoothing is glossy.In wide temperature range, have excellent physical and mechanical properties, life-time service temperature can reach 120 DEG C, and electrical insulating property is excellent, even under high-temperature high-frequency, its electrical property is still better, but corona resistance is poor, creep resistance, resistance to fatigue, rub resistance, dimensional stability are all fine.
Summary of the invention:
For prior art above shortcomings, one of technical problem to be solved by this invention is to provide a kind of antistatic wood powder PET composite material.
Two of technical problem to be solved by this invention is to provide the preparation method of above-mentioned antistatic wood powder PET composite material.
Technical problem of the present invention, is achieved by following technical proposals:
A kind of antistatic wood powder PET composite material, is made up of the raw material of following weight part: 50-70 part PET, 30-50 part wood powder, the agent of 4-8 part compound coupling compatibility, 1-3 part composite antistatic agent.
The agent of described compound coupling compatibility, is made up of the raw material of following weight part: erucicamide 10-30 part, MA-g-PP compatilizer 50-70 part, 3-TSL 8330 10-30 part and MA-g-PE compatilizer 10-30 part.
Described composite antistatic agent, be made up of by weight following component: stearamidopropyl dimethyl-beta-hydroxyethyl quaternary ammonium nitrate 10-30 part, glyceryl monostearate 30-60 part, two (2-hydroxyethyl)-the N-(3 '-dodecyloxy-2 of N, N-'-hydroxypropyl) methylsulfuric acid ammonium methyl 20-40 part, (3-dodecanamide propyl) trimethylammonium sulfate methyl ammonium 5-10 part.
Erucicamide, English name: Erucylamide; Cis-13-Docosenoamide; (Z)-13-Docosenamide, CAS NO.112-84-5.
MA-g-PP compatilizer, is called: maleic anhydride inoculated polypropylene, also known as: maleic anhydride-polypropylene graft copolymer.Its commercial grades has: the Polybond3200 of Epolene-43, Epolene G-3003, Youmex1010, Chemtura Corporation.
3-TSL 8330, CAS No:13822-56-5.
MA-g-PE compatilizer, is called MA-g-PE grafting copolymer.Its commercial grades has: Polybond3009, Youmex CA60 of Chemtura Corporation.
Erucicamide, MA-g-PP compatilizer, 3-TSL 8330 and MA-g-PE compatilizer are uniformly mixed, this compound coupling compatibility agent can be obtained.
Stearamidopropyl dimethyl-beta-hydroxyethyl quaternary ammonium nitrate, English name: Stearamidopropyldimethyl-β-hydroxyethyl ammonium nitrate, trade(brand)name: Cyastat SN, another name: static inhibitor SN.CAS accession number: 86443-82-5
Glyceryl monostearate, has another name called mono-glycerides, English name: Monostearin; Alpha-Monostearin; Octadecanoic acid2,3-dihydroxypropyl ester; Glycerin1-monostearate.CAS accession number: 123-94-4.
N, two (2-hydroxyethyl)-the N-(3 '-dodecyloxy-2 of N-'-hydroxypropyl) methylsulfuric acid ammonium methyl, English name: N, N-bis(2-hydroxyethyl)-N--(3 '-dodecyloxy-2 '-hydroxypropyl) methyl ammonium methosulfate, another name: static inhibitor 609.
(3-dodecanamide propyl) trimethylammonium sulfate methyl ammonium, English name: (3-lauramidopropyl) trimethyl ammonium methyl sulfate, another name: static inhibitor LS.
By stearamidopropyl dimethyl-beta-hydroxyethyl quaternary ammonium nitrate, glyceryl monostearate, N, two (2-hydroxyethyl)-the N-(3 '-dodecyloxy-2 of N-'-hydroxypropyl) methylsulfuric acid ammonium methyl and (3-dodecanamide propyl) trimethylammonium sulfate methyl ammonium be uniformly mixed, and can obtain this composite antistatic agent.
Adopt the method that the industry is general, antistatic wood powder PET composite material of the present invention can be obtained.
Present invention also offers a kind of preparation method of antistatic wood powder PET composite material:
(1) erucicamide, MA-g-PP compatilizer, 3-TSL 8330 and MA-g-PE compatilizer are uniformly mixed, obtained compound coupling compatibility agent;
(2) by stearamidopropyl dimethyl-beta-hydroxyethyl quaternary ammonium nitrate, glyceryl monostearate, N, two (2-hydroxyethyl)-the N-(3 '-dodecyloxy-2 of N-'-hydroxypropyl) methylsulfuric acid ammonium methyl and (3-dodecanamide propyl) trimethylammonium sulfate methyl ammonium be uniformly mixed, obtained composite antistatic agent;
(3) by wood powder 160-220 DEG C heat drying, controlling dried wood powder water content is 0.2-0.8wt%;
(4) agent of compound coupling compatibility is added in dried wood powder, stir at 60-90 DEG C, obtained modified wood powder;
(5) modified wood powder, PET and composite antistatic agent are mixed, blended in Banbury mixer, obtained antistatic wood powder PET composite material of the present invention.
Preferably,
Described wood powder is pine powder, Poplar Powder, Liu An wood powder, Chinese juniper wood powder or fir powder.
Described wood powder particle diameter is 50-200 order.
In described step (5), by modified wood powder, PET and composite antistatic agent mix, at 170-190 DEG C in Banbury mixer blended 10-20min, Banbury mixer rotating speed 50-100rpm.
Antistatic wood powder PET composite material prepared by the present invention has shock strength, flexural strength and spring rate, and special surface resistivity is low, and surface has antistatic property, not dust suction, and goods can be made to keep attractive in appearance for a long time.
Embodiment:
Embodiment further illustrates of the present invention below, instead of limit the scope of the invention.
Following examples and comparative example PET used are Shu Er Man of the U.S. injection grade trade mark: cg007-94031PET; Wood powder is pine powder, particle diameter 70-80 order; MA-g-PP compatilizer, the Polybond3200 of Chemtura Corporation; MA-g-PE compatilizer, the Polybond3009 of Chemtura Corporation.
Embodiment 1
(1) erucicamide 20 grams, MA-g-PP compatilizer 60 grams, 3-TSL 8330 20 grams and MA-g-PE compatilizer 20 grams is taken.Each raw material stirring is mixed, this compound coupling compatibility agent can be obtained.
(2) by stearamidopropyl dimethyl-20 grams, beta-hydroxyethyl quaternary ammonium nitrate, glyceryl monostearate 45 grams, N, two (2-hydroxyethyl)-the N-(3 '-dodecyloxy-2 of N-'-hydroxypropyl) methylsulfuric acid ammonium methyl 30 grams and (3-dodecanamide propyl) trimethylammonium sulfate methyl ammonium 7.5 grams be uniformly mixed, obtained composite antistatic agent.
(3) by wood powder at 200 DEG C of heat dryings, controlling dried wood powder water content is about 0.6wt%;
(4) take above-mentioned compound coupling compatibility agent 60 grams to join in dried 400 grams of wood powders, stir at 80 DEG C, obtained modified wood powder;
(5) by modified wood powder, the mixing of 600 grams of PET and 20 gram of composite antistatic agents, at 180 DEG C in Haake Banbury mixer blended 15min, Banbury mixer rotating speed 80rpm, obtained antistatic wood powder PET composite material.
Compressing tablet preparation standard batten on compression molding instrument, carries out performance test subsequently.Test result is as shown in table 1.
Comparative example 1
Dried for 600gPET and 400g pine powder (about water content 0.6wt%) is mixed, at 180 DEG C in Haake Banbury mixer blended 15min, Banbury mixer rotating speed 80rpm, obtain pure antistatic wood powder PET composite material.Compressing tablet preparation standard batten on compression molding instrument, carries out performance test subsequently.Test result is as shown in table 1.
Comparative example 2
(1) by wood powder at 200 DEG C of heat dryings, controlling dried wood powder water content is about 0.6wt%;
(2) take MA-g-PP compatilizer 60 grams to join in dried 400 grams of wood powders, stir at 80 DEG C, obtained modified wood powder;
(3) modified wood powder is mixed with 600 grams of PET, at 180 DEG C in Haake Banbury mixer blended 15min, Banbury mixer rotating speed 80rpm, obtained antistatic wood powder PET composite material.
Compressing tablet preparation standard batten on compression molding instrument, carries out performance test subsequently.Test result is as shown in table 1.
Table 1
Shock strength, KJ/m 2 Flexural strength, MPa Spring rate, × 10 4kg·cm/cm 2 Surface resistivity, Ω
Embodiment 1 6.0 40.2 3.1 4.5×10 8
Comparative example 1 4.2 34.6 2.5 4.2×10 14
Comparative example 2 5.2 37.9 2.8 4.4×10 14
As can be seen from Table 1, compared with adopting the antistatic wood powder PET composite material of compound coupling compatibility of the present invention agent and not adding the antistatic wood powder PET composite material of compound coupling compatibility agent process, there is good shock strength, flexural strength and spring rate.Compared with adopting the antistatic wood powder PET composite material of compound coupling compatibility of the present invention agent and adding separately a kind of antistatic wood powder PET composite material of coupling agent treatment, there is better shock strength, flexural strength and spring rate.Therefore, antistatic wood powder PET composite material prepared by the present invention has shock strength, flexural strength and spring rate, and special surface resistivity is low, and surface has antistatic property, not dust suction, and goods can be made to keep attractive in appearance for a long time.
